Latest Patents

Nishijima holds a patent for a "Superconducting magnet device and method for limiting current decrease in case of abnormality therein." This invention includes a superconducting coil made from high-temperature superconducting wire, a power supply that delivers current to the coil, and a protector that creates a short-circuit path to safeguard the device during abnormalities. The superconducting coil generates a magnetic field when current flows in a superconducting state. Upon detecting an abnormality or disconnection, the protector activates the short-circuit path to ensure safety and functionality.
